I bought my boat in to Sun Fun Marine to have an Impeller replaced in 2005. After several weeks of constant phone calls, I was told the boat was finally ready. After taking it on the water, My heat alarm went off and the engine cut off. I had to be towed back to the dock.
As it turns out, the drive shaft had bored a hole thru the power head of my outboard motor due to the technician misaligning the drive shaft on reinstallation. This was a $5000 repair that Mike Smith determined couldn't have possibly happened due to their negligence at Sun Fun Marine.
I took the boat to a reputable dealership who informed me that indeed, Sun Fun Marine was the culprit. Mike Smith continued to deny any responsibility and I reported this to the Better Business Bureau of Columbus, Ohio. Unfortunately, there was nothing they could do to resolve this matter.
Luckily, Mercury Marine stepped up and replaced the damage power head but I was still out $1200 on the rebuild of which Sun Fun Marine refused to assist with the cost.
Sun Fun Marine is not a reputable shop and they do not stand behind their work. They will deny any responsibility for damage they cause and if you take your boat there for anything, you're taking a awful risk.

SUMMER IS USUALLY A TWO-THREE WEEK TURN AROUND TIME, SO SEVERAL WEEKS IS NOT UNUSUAL.
THIS CUSTOMER CHOSE NOT TO TAKE THE MOTOR TO THE DEALER ACROSS THE STREET WHERE HE BOUGHT IT, USED, BUT INSTEAD BROUGHT IT TO US!
AFTER HE HAD AN OIL ISSUE WE FOUND IT HAD BEEN ASSEMBLED INCORRECTLY DURING PRIOR WORK, WHICH IS HOW OVER SEVERAL SEASONS THE SHIFT SHAFT WORE A HOLE THROUGH THE ALUMINUM CASTING. SINCE THIS AREA IS HIDDEN UNDER THE POWER HEAD, IT WAS NOT DISCOVERED UNTIL THE PROBLEM BECAME WORSE. (OIL ALARM SOUNDED, NOT HEAT) (SHIFT SHAFT, NOT DRIVE SHAFT)
I MADE THE CALLS, WHICH GOT THE PROBLEM RESOLVED THROUGH MERCURY WARRANTY AND AT A VERY REASONABLE COST. CONSIDERING THIS WAS A "USED" MOTOR, I FEEL THIS CUSTOMER GOT A FAIR DEAL.
I WAS TOLD THE SELLING DEALER WOULD NOT WORK ON THIS CUSTOMERS MOTOR. WISH WE HAD NOT EITHER!
